现货库存,2小时发货,提供寄样和解决方案
热搜关键词:
单片机是一种常用的嵌入式系统控制器,它通常需要与其他设备进行通信。在单片机中,常用的通信方式包括串口通信、并口通信、SPI通信和I2C通信等。代理销售全球知名品牌单片机代理商金沙娱场城app7979将针对这些通信方式进行介绍,并着重介绍常用的数据包结构。
1. 串口通信
串口通信是一种常用的单片机通信方式,它通过串行传输数据,具有简单、稳定等优点。在串口通信中,常用的数据包结构为帧格式,包括起始位、数据位、校验位和停止位等。其中起始位和停止位用于标识数据包的开始和结束,数据位用于传输数据,校验位用于检测数据传输的正确性。
2. 并口通信
并口通信是一种通过并行传输数据的单片机通信方式,它具有传输速度快等优点。在并口通信中,常用的数据包结构为数据总线格式,包括地址线、数据线和控制线等。其中地址线用于标识设备地址,数据线用于传输数据,控制线用于控制数据传输的开始和结束。
3. SPI通信
SPI通信是一种常用的同步串行接口通信方式,它具有高速传输、可靠性强等优点。在SPI通信中,常用的数据包结构为帧格式,包括起始位、数据位和停止位等。其中起始位和停止位用于标识数据包的开始和结束,数据位用于传输数据。
4. I2C通信
I2C通信是一种常用的串行接口通信方式,它具有双向传输、多设备共享等优点。在I2C通信中,常用的数据包结构为帧格式,包括起始位、地址位、数据位和停止位等。其中起始位和停止位用于标识数据包的开始和结束,地址位用于标识设备地址,数据位用于传输数据。
单片机常用的通信方式包括串口通信、并口通信、SPI通信和I2C通信等。而常用的数据包结构则包括帧格式和数据总线格式等。在实际应用中,选择合适的通信方式和数据包结构,能够提高单片机的通信效率和可靠性。